Fallen Patriot Commemoration
This Interactive American Flag is dedicated to:
U.S. Army Specialist
Douglas J. Weismantle of Pittsburgh, PA
[ listed as 2nd of 12 residents of Pittsburgh to be killed in GWOT (Global War on Terror) ]
SPC Weismantle, 28, served as part of Operation Iraqi Freedom (OIF)
with the Headquarters & Headquarters Company, 1st Battalion, 325th Airborne Infantry Regiment, 82nd Airborne deployed from Fort Bragg, NC
Died tragically, on Oct. 13, 2003, when an Iraqi dump truck rolled over on top of his Humvee in Baghdad, Iraq
We honor and thank Army Specialist Weismantle for defending our freedoms and fighting to liberate the lives of others.

Patriot Honor Roll
Here is an example tribute to imitate / replace. Add in your relatives, friends, mentors, etc. who serve as "patriots" to you - motivating you to stand proudly during Flag ceremonies while thinking of their efforts to make America better and spread its voice of freedom.
[ THIS IS THE FLAG STEWARD FOUNDER'S EXAMPLE HONOR ROLL TRIBUTE TO HIS DAD - WHOSE MEMORIAL FLAGPOLE INSPIRED THIS NONPROFIT PROJECT ]
The personal Patriot(s) remembered by this Interactive American Flag include(s):
U.S. Army (Retired) Lieutenant Colonel
Edward J. Sweeney Jr.
Vietnam Veteran from Boston, Massachusetts
20 year Army career (1967-1987) in Aviation and Corps of Engineers
Awarded Silver Star, Bronze Star, and 45 Air Medals while serving as scout helicopter pilot ( shot down 3 times ;) in Vietnam
Died December 8, 2008, age 62, of a Vietnam War related illness
Survived by wife, Ellen Sweeney, two children and three grandchildren
We honor and thank U.S. Army Lieutenant Colonel Ed Sweeney Jr. for defending our freedoms and fighting to liberate the lives of others.
Ed Sweeney Jr. inspires us with his leadership - how he looked out for the welfare of his men:
Chief Warrant Officer Frank Glenn, a fellow Vietnam War scout helicopter pilot of Platoon Leader Ed Sweeney, repeated Captain Sweeney's directive to his 9 scout pilots, "Don't be a cowboy, don't take any unnecessary risks, no hot-dogging, and don't get your crew killed. Your job is to return to base everyday."
